ruleMorocco is a safe destination for solo female travelers.
Dress modestly to avoid unwanted attention and avoid walking alone in secluded areas after dark. Be mindful of your belongings and politely decline persistent offers of assistance. Many women travel solo without issues.

riskTaxi app usage in Morocco (InDriver, Yango) is officially prohibited, leading to potential conflicts with local taxi drivers and law enforcement.
Drivers using these apps may face issues. It's advisable to use cash for taxi services. Drivers might not be able to pick up passengers directly at certain locations like mall entrances or airports, requiring a short walk. In case of police inquiries, identifying oneself as a 'friend' (Monami) might be helpful, though not all officials speak French.

riskBe vigilant against pickpocketing attempts on flights, particularly the night flight to Casablanca.
A group of five individuals was reported to be involved in attempted theft from overhead luggage during a flight. The perpetrators targeted passengers while they were sleeping. Incidents are known to airline staff, and airport authorities may be alerted if such passengers are identified on a flight. Passengers should secure their belongings and remain aware of their surroundings.

riskDriving at night in Morocco presents challenges, primarily due to unlit roads outside of cities.
While unexpected animal crossings can occur even during the day, nighttime driving requires extra caution. However, many drivers find it manageable, especially compared to other African regions. It is generally advisable to travel before sunset if possible.

riskDriving in Morocco requires extreme caution, especially at roundabouts.
Common hazards include large trucks ignoring lane markings, sudden maneuvers without indicators, and unpredictable motorcycle/moped traffic. Cities like Tangier are noted for chaotic traffic conditions.

tipAvoid hailing random 'red' taxis due to unpredictable pricing.
Use ride-hailing apps like InDrive for local travel. For airport transfers, book in advance and ensure you have local mobile connectivity to coordinate via WhatsApp.

riskWhen arranging transfers in Morocco, be cautious of individuals offering services via unsolicited messages.
Scammers often request a deposit upfront and then disappear. Always book through reputable companies or official airport services to avoid fraud.
